What is Insulin Human (Rdna)?
Humulin N is a recombinant human insulin (rDNA) supplied as an injectable solution for subcutaneous or intramuscular administration. It is a prescription‑only antidiabetic medication marketed in the European Union. The product contains insulin human (rDNA) as its active ingredient and is classified in the insulin therapeutic class. Humulin N is intended for use in adults with diabetes mellitus to provide basal insulin coverage, it is stored in a refrigerator until needed.
What is Insulin Human (Rdna) used for?
Humulin N is prescribed as a basal insulin to help manage blood glucose levels in patients with diabetes mellitus.
- Type 1 diabetes mellitus (adults and children) - Type 2 diabetes mellitus requiring basal insulin - Gestational diabetes when oral agents are insufficient - Adjunct therapy with rapid‑acting insulin for basal‑bolus regimens - Use in patients transitioning from other intermediate‑acting insulins - Supplemental basal insulin for patients with inadequate glycemic control on oral hypoglycemics alone - Part of a basal‑bolus insulin regimen in hospital settings for peri‑operative glucose management
What are the side effects of Insulin Human (Rdna)?
Adverse reactions to Humulin N can vary in frequency and severity, ranging from mild injection‑site symptoms to rare systemic events.
Common: - Hypoglycemia, presenting as sweating, tremor, or confusion - Pain, redness or bruising at the injection site - Lipodystrophy (localized lipoatrophy or lipohypertrophy) at repeated injection sites - Weight gain associated with improved glycemic control - Mild allergic skin reactions such as rash or urticaria - Peripheral edema, especially with high doses - Transient visual disturbances such as blurred vision
Serious: - Severe hypoglycemia requiring assistance - Anaphylactic reaction with respiratory distress or shock - Significant hypokalemia leading to cardiac arrhythmias - Formation of insulin antibodies causing unpredictable glucose response - Acute pancreatitis with abdominal pain and elevated enzymes
What precautions apply to Insulin Human (Rdna)?
When prescribing Humulin N, clinicians should evaluate patient‑specific factors and monitor for conditions that may alter insulin requirements or increase risk of adverse events.
- Assess renal and hepatic function because impairment may reduce insulin clearance. - Review history of hypoglycemia unawareness and adjust dose accordingly. - Consider pregnancy and lactation status; insulin requirements often change. - Evaluate for cardiovascular disease; rapid glucose shifts can affect cardiac stability. - Monitor weight and signs of fluid retention during therapy. - Screen for allergic reactions to insulin or excipients. - Educate patients on proper injection technique and rotation of sites.
What does Insulin Human (Rdna) interact with?
Humulin N may interact with other medications that affect glucose metabolism, potassium balance, or insulin sensitivity, requiring dose adjustments or monitoring.
Avoid: - Concomitant use of other rapid‑acting insulins without proper dose reduction (risk of severe hypoglycemia). - Beta‑blockers masking hypoglycemia symptoms. - High‑dose corticosteroids increasing insulin resistance. - MAO‑inhibitors potentiating hypoglycemic effect. - Thiazide diuretics causing hypokalemia.
Use with caution: - Oral hypoglycemic agents (e.g., sulfonylureas) may enhance glucose‑lowering effect. - ACE inhibitors may modestly increase insulin sensitivity. - Lipid‑lowering agents (statins) have minimal interaction but monitor liver function. - Antidepressants (SSRIs) may affect appetite and weight. - Contrast media used in imaging may transiently affect glucose control.
